How to travel from Cudillero to A Coruna Airport (LCG), Spain

The distance between Cudillero and A Coruna Airport (LCG) is around 226km (140 miles) and the quickest way to get there is to drive which takes around 2h 10m.

Bus travel

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Cudillero and A Coruna Airport (LCG). It typically takes around 3h 20m and departs once daily.

There are no direct bus services that runs from Cudillero to A Coruna Airport (LCG). However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Luarca, Ferrol and A Coruña. These services run once daily and will take a minimum of 3h 20m.

ALSA and MonBus run regular bus services between Cudillero and A Coruna Airport (LCG). Buses run once daily and take around 3h 20m on average but will vary depending on you book with.
